Silk reinforced silk-fibroin-based composites were prepared by embedding of silk textile into regenerated silk fibroin(RSF)matrix. The breaking stress and breaking strain of the composites were found 37.7 MPa and 71.1% respectively at(95 ± 5)% RH.Morphological analysis was carried out to observe fracture behavior of the samples. The in vitro biodegradation test showed that the composite degraded slowly and lost 70% weight at the end of 168 h. Moreover, compared with RSF pure film, the composite kept strength and toughness much longer time. In conclusion, this composite has the potential for more accurate cytology research and biomedical tests in the future. 相似文献

Summary : Pulp reactivity is a kinetic term and is always connected with a certain derivatization process. The quality and hence the market value of the pulp is determined by such characteristics as α- cellulose content, solubility, brightness, ash content, as well as the amount of soluble material in dichloromethane. However, solubility data, especially S18 and S10 values do not characterise dissolving pulp reactivity. These are indicative of pulp solubility and provide some information regarding losses of material during pulp processing. One way by which the pulp reactivity for viscose making can be characterised is the investigation of the mercerisation step. Following the mercerisation kinetics by help of the molecular weight distribution of cellulose II the behaviour especially of the high molecular weight cellulose gives information regarding the accessibility and therefore, about the reactivity of the pulp aside from losses in low molecular weight cellulose. This behaviour will be shown on different pulps and the physicochemical background will be discussed in relation to results obtained from wide angle X-ray scattering and Raman investigations. The influence of the behaviour of the pulp during mercerising on the viscose process, and the molecular weight distribution of the viscose including the distribution of the xanthogenate groups along the chain was investigated and will also be discussed. 相似文献

Summary: The thermal and structural analysis of silk fibroin (SF) and silk sericin (SS) blend films reveals that the crystallization of SF is retarded in the presence of SS. Although a phase separation was observed, there might be a strong interaction at the boundary of the SF and SS through intermolecular hydrogen bonding, which restricts the conformational transition of SF.

通过盐酸肼交联羧甲基化黏胶纤维制得具有吸湿发热功能的黏胶纤维,讨论了纤维在吸湿发热量、断裂强度、热性能及微观结构等方面的特性.结果表明:当纤维中氮的质量分数为2%~4%,回潮率为25%~26%(相对湿度90%)时,纤维吸湿发热效果明显,发热量最高可达7.67J/g;交联使纤维的湿断裂强度明显提高,湿干强度比可提高16.... 相似文献

Spiders have a bad reputation because of their predacious and hidden way of life. Nevertheless, they developed a finely tuned system, based on the use of venom and silk, which enabled them to compete successfully in evolution. Only recently has the mystery of the chemistry of their silk and venom begun to unravel, although the first investigations were performed at the beginning of this century and in the fifties. The silk and toxins are made of proteins, but low molecular weight compounds are also present, too. Among these small molecules are compounds not known from any other natural source. For this reason the following article will focus on the structure and function of the low molecular weight components of the silk and the venom. 相似文献

Silicon carbide whiskers (SiCW) were synthesized through sol-gel process by impregnating the rayon fibres with sols of methyltriethoxysilane (MTEOS), phenyltriethoxysilane (PTEOS) and dimethyldiethoxysilane (DMDEOS) and pyrolyzing the impregnated rayon fibres at 1400°C in argon atmosphere. The SiCW synthesized through this method were needle like, straight and their aspect ratio was found to be greater than 100 except in the case where DMDEOS was used as silica source. 相似文献
